What Makes a UK Online Casino Trustworthy?
A reputable casino should clearly identify its operator, licensing details and customer support channels. In Great Britain, licensed gambling websites are expected to follow strict rules covering player protection, advertising, identity checks and the handling of customer funds. Look for licensing information in the website footer and verify that the details are consistent with the operator named in the terms and conditions.
Security is another essential consideration. A quality casino uses encrypted connections to protect account information and payment data. It should also provide transparent privacy policies, secure login features and clear explanations of how personal information is processed. Strong operators do not hide important rules in confusing or inaccessible pages.

Casino Games and Software Quality
The game selection should match your preferences rather than simply being as large as possible. Most leading UK casinos offer slots, table games, jackpots and live dealer titles. Slots may include classic fruit machines, themed video games and progressive jackpots, while table sections commonly feature roulette, blackjack, baccarat and casino poker.
Software providers are also worth checking. Established studios usually publish information about game rules, return-to-player percentages and volatility. The return-to-player figure is a theoretical long-term average, not a guarantee of a particular result. Short sessions can produce outcomes that are very different from the advertised percentage, so games should always be treated as entertainment rather than a source of income.

Understanding Bonuses and Promotions
Casino promotions can include welcome bonuses, free spins, reload offers, cashback and loyalty rewards. Before accepting any offer, read the full promotional terms. Important details often include the minimum deposit, maximum bonus amount, wagering requirement, maximum bet restriction, eligible games, withdrawal limits and the time allowed to complete the promotion.
A bonus with a large headline value may be less useful than a smaller offer with fairer conditions. For example, a high wagering requirement can make it difficult to withdraw winnings linked to bonus funds. Players should also check whether a deposit is required and whether free spins apply only to selected games. Comparing the complete terms is more reliable than judging an offer by its advertised amount alone.
Payment Speed and Account Verification
Deposits are usually processed quickly, but withdrawals may require additional checks. Identity verification is a standard part of regulated gambling and can involve proof of identity, address and payment ownership. Completing verification early may help prevent delays when requesting a withdrawal.
Payment availability varies by operator, but common options can include debit cards, bank transfers and selected digital wallets. Always confirm processing times, transaction limits and possible fees before depositing. Never use another person’s payment method, as this can lead to account restrictions and failed withdrawals.

Responsible Gambling in the UK
Online casino gaming should remain affordable, controlled and enjoyable. Set a budget before playing and avoid chasing losses. Regulated operators generally provide tools that allow customers to set deposit limits, session reminders, reality checks and temporary time-outs. Self-exclusion services are also available for people who need a longer break from gambling.
Warning signs can include spending more than planned, hiding gambling activity, borrowing money to play or feeling unable to stop. If gambling is becoming difficult to control, pause immediately and seek support from a recognised organisation such as GamCare.
